Industri og produktion: Processernes vogter<\/p>\n\n\n\n<p>I produktionen er kv\u00e6lstofs inerti - dets modvilje mod at reagere med andre stoffer - dets superkraft.<\/p>\n\n\n\n<p>Inertisering og udrensning: Nitrogen bruges til at udrense luft og fugt fra r\u00f8rledninger, reaktorer og lagertanke i industrier som den kemiske, petrokemiske og farmaceutiske.  Det forhindrer dannelsen af eksplosive blandinger og stopper u\u00f8nsket oxidering under produktoverf\u00f8rsel eller -opbevaring.<\/p>\n\n\n\n<p>Lodning og h\u00e5rdlodning: Ved at skabe et iltfrit milj\u00f8 forhindrer nitrogen oxidering under metalforbindelsen ved h\u00f8j temperatur, hvilket resulterer i renere, st\u00e6rkere og mere p\u00e5lidelige loddefuger i elektronikproduktionen.<\/p>\n\n\n\n<p>Lasersk\u00e6ring: Anvendt som hj\u00e6lpegas producerer nitrogen rene, oxidfri snit p\u00e5 metaller som rustfrit st\u00e5l og aluminium og efterlader en svejseklar kant.<\/p>\n\n\n\n<p>Oppumpning af d\u00e6k: Fyldning af d\u00e6k med t\u00f8r nitrogen minimerer tryksvingninger for\u00e5rsaget af temperatur\u00e6ndringer, forbedrer br\u00e6ndstofeffektiviteten og reducerer f\u00e6lgkorrosion ved at fjerne ilt og fugt.<\/p>\n\n\n\n<p>2.  F\u00f8devare- og drikkevareindustrien: Bevarelse af friskhed<\/p>\n\n\n\n<p>Her er kv\u00e6lstof en vigtig allieret til at forl\u00e6nge holdbarheden og bevare kvaliteten.<\/p>\n\n\n\n<p>Emballage med modificeret atmosf\u00e6re (MAP): Nitrogen bruges til at fortr\u00e6nge ilt i f\u00f8devareemballage (til snacks, kaffe, mejeriprodukter og f\u00e6rdigretter).  Det bremser ford\u00e6rvelsen, forhindrer harskning og h\u00e6mmer v\u00e6ksten af aerobe bakterier, s\u00e5 produkterne holder sig friske i l\u00e6ngere tid.<\/p>\n\n\n\n<p>Udsk\u00e6nkning af drikkevarer: I barer og bryggerier bruges kv\u00e6lstoftryk til at udsk\u00e6nke \u00f8l (som stout) og cocktails, hvilket skaber en karakteristisk glat, cremet konsistens med fine bobler (\"nitro brew\").<\/p>\n\n\n\n<p>3.  Videnskab og laboratorium: Enabler af pr\u00e6cision<\/p>\n\n\n\n<p>I laboratorier er renhed og kontrol altafg\u00f8rende.<\/p>\n\n\n\n<p>Gaskromatografi (GC) og v\u00e6skekromatografi (LC-MS): Nitrogen med ultrah\u00f8j renhed (ofte 99,999% eller h\u00f8jere) fungerer som b\u00e6regas eller t\u00f8rregas, hvilket er afg\u00f8rende for den n\u00f8jagtige analyse af komplekse kemiske blandinger.<\/p>\n\n\n\n<p>Konservering af pr\u00f8ver: Nitrogen bruges til at d\u00e6kke f\u00f8lsomme kemiske og biologiske pr\u00f8ver, s\u00e5 de ikke nedbrydes, n\u00e5r de uds\u00e6ttes for luft.<\/p>\n\n\n\n<p>Fryset\u00f8rring (lyofilisering): Det bruges som en inert gas til at lette sublimeringsprocessen under fryset\u00f8rring af l\u00e6gemidler, vacciner og biologiske materialer.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-large\"><img alt=\"\" decoding=\"async\" width=\"1024\" height=\"507\" src=\"https:\/\/darkslategray-hippopotamus-243231.hostingersite.com\/wp-content\/uploads\/2025\/12\/2025120802-1024x507.jpg\" class=\"wp-image-6836\" srcset=\"https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802-1024x507.jpg 1024w, https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802-300x148.jpg 300w, https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802-768x380.jpg 768w, https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802-18x9.jpg 18w, https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802-600x297.jpg 600w, https:\/\/hsgascylinder-factory.com\/wp-content\/uploads\/2025\/12\/2025120802.jpg 1182w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<p>4.  Medicin og sundhedspleje: Den tavse beskytter<\/p>\n\n\n\n<p>Mens ilt af medicinsk kvalitet er afg\u00f8rende for patienterne, spiller nitrogen en afg\u00f8rende rolle som st\u00f8tte.<\/p>\n\n\n\n<p>Kirurgiske v\u00e6rkt\u00f8jer: Driver pneumatisk kirurgisk udstyr og v\u00e6rkt\u00f8j.<\/p>\n\n\n\n<p>Kryopr\u00e6servering: Flydende nitrogen (den ultrakolde flydende form af N\u2082) bruges til at konservere biologiske pr\u00f8ver som blod, v\u00e6v, s\u00e6d og embryoner i specialiserede dewars.<\/p>\n\n\n\n<p>Farmaceutisk produktion: I lighed med industrielle anvendelser giver det en inert atmosf\u00e6re til produktion og emballering af iltf\u00f8lsomme l\u00e6gemidler.<\/p>\n\n\n\n<p>5.  Sikkerhed og specialiserede applikationer<\/p>\n\n\n\n<p>Brandbek\u00e6mpelse: I nogle systemer bruges nitrogen til at inertere lukkede rum, hvilket reducerer iltniveauet til under t\u00e6rsklen for forbr\u00e6nding uden at efterlade rester som traditionelle brandslukkere.<\/p>\n\n\n\n<p>Luft- og rumfart og dykning: Bruges i jordst\u00f8tteudstyr og i blanding med ilt (Nitrox) som \u00e5ndingsgas til dykkere for at reducere risikoen for kv\u00e6lstofnarkose.<\/p>\n\n\n\n<p>Olie og gas: Bruges til br\u00f8ndstimulering, trykpr\u00f8vning af r\u00f8rledninger og inertisering.<\/p>\n\n\n\n<p>At v\u00e6lge den rigtige cylinder: Sikkerhed f\u00f8rst<\/p>\n\n\n\n<p>Nitrogenflasker findes i forskellige st\u00f8rrelser, fra sm\u00e5 b\u00e6rbare laboratorieflasker til store industrielle \"r\u00f8rtrailere\".
